Consent for Treatment Form: A Comprehensive How-to Guide

Understanding the consent for treatment form

A consent for treatment form is a crucial document used in healthcare settings, designed to ensure that patients are fully informed about their treatment options and agree to the procedures they will undergo. This form serves not only to protect the rights of patients but also to safeguard healthcare providers against potential legal issues that may arise from unauthorized treatments.

The legal implications of consent are significant. Patients have the right to be informed about their medical conditions and the potential risks and benefits of any proposed treatment. Failure to obtain proper consent can lead to legal consequences for healthcare providers, including malpractice claims.

When is a consent for treatment necessary?

Consent is necessary in various situations, especially when a patient is undergoing surgical procedures, diagnostic tests, or experimental treatments. For routine services, verbal consent may suffice; however, for significant interventions, written consent is typically required to document that the patient has been adequately informed.

It's essential to understand the differences between verbal and written consent. Verbal consent, while acceptable in some cases, may lack the necessary documentation to protect both parties, especially in disputes or legal situations.

Key elements of a consent for treatment form

Creating an effective consent for treatment form involves including several essential components. The form should begin with detailed patient information, including their name, date of birth, and contact details. Next, it should outline the treatment or procedure, ensuring patients are well-informed about what to expect.

Importantly, the form must present a clear description of the risks and benefits associated with the treatment. Patients need this information to make informed decisions regarding their health. Beyond these, special considerations must be taken into account, especially when dealing with minors or unconscious patients who may not be able to provide consent.

Language and accessibility are also vital. The consent form should be easy to understand, employing plain language rather than medical jargon, and available in multiple languages if necessary.

Crafting a consent for treatment form

To effectively create a consent for treatment form, follow these step-by-step instructions:

Identify the treatment or procedure for which consent is being sought.
Clearly include details about the involved parties—make sure to identify both the patient and the healthcare provider.
Outline the risks and benefits associating with the treatment, ensuring clarity and transparency.
Include contact information for follow-up questions, providing a resource for patients to seek further clarification.

When drafting the form, ensure you avoid medical jargon. Use straightforward language that patients can easily understand. Examples can illustrate complex ideas, making the consent process more transparent.

Best practices for handling consent in healthcare

To maintain patient trust and transparency, healthcare providers must prioritize effective communication when obtaining consent. This means actively engaging patients, ensuring they understand their rights, and encouraging them to ask questions about their treatment options.

Regularly reviewing and updating consent forms is also critical. Healthcare practices should establish a schedule to revise these documents, particularly when there are legislative changes or updates in medical practice that may impact the consent process.

Consent for treatment is a legal and ethical agreement obtained from a patient or their authorized representative, allowing a healthcare provider to administer medical care or procedures.
The healthcare provider or the medical facility is required to file consent for treatment, ensuring that patients understand and agree to the proposed medical interventions.
To fill out consent for treatment, the patient or their representative should read the document carefully, understand the nature of the treatment, its risks and benefits, and provide their signature to indicate their agreement.
The purpose of consent for treatment is to ensure that patients are informed about their medical care, have the opportunity to ask questions, and voluntarily agree to the treatment, thereby protecting their autonomy and rights.
The consent for treatment must report the patient's name, the nature of the treatment or procedure, potential risks and benefits, alternatives to the treatment, and a statement indicating that the patient has had the opportunity to ask questions.
